Problems that tin roof repair services help solve include leaks, rust, corrosion, and physical damage caused by severe weather or aging materials. Over time, exposure to rain, snow, and wind can lead to deterioration, resulting in issues such as holes, loose panels, or compromised seams. Repairing these problems promptly can prevent water from seeping into the interior, which could cause structural damage, mold growth, or interior water stains. Addressing corrosion and rust also helps maintain the roof’s durability and appearance.

Installation Costs - The cost to install a new roof can range from approximately $5,000 to $15,000, depending on the size and material chosen. For example, a standard residential roof replacement might be around $8,000. Local pros can provide specific estimates based on the project's scope.
Repair Expenses - Repairing damaged or leaking roofs typically costs between $300 and $1,500. Minor fixes, such as replacing a few shingles, may be closer to $300, while more extensive repairs could approach $1,500 or more.
Material Pricing - The cost of roofing materials varies widely, with asphalt shingles averaging $100 to $150 per square (100 square feet). Metal roofing might range from $300 to $700 per square, influencing overall project costs.
Inspection and Maintenance - Roof inspections generally cost between $150 and $300, while routine maintenance services could be around $200 to $500. These services help identify issues early and extend the lifespan of the roof.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
